Description

This newly renovated home is located on Caney Creek and only minutes to the Intracoastal Waterway, Mitchell's Cut, the San Bernard River and East Matagorda Bay by boat and a few miles to Sargent Beach by car. Fish off of the pier day or night, or sit under the porch and enjoy the sites of the day and the sea breeze. The space Newly renovated and decorated in coastal tones, this home features an open concept living and dining area with windows that let in the light and the views of the creek and sunset. Other things to note This home is equipped with towels, bedding, basic soaps, shampoo/conditioner, extra blankets, and kitchen basics including basic spices. You will want to come to the house with your groceries and other necessary supplies. The town has two dollar stores, a few restaurants, and a Texaco with general store-type supplies. There is no grocery store, no Uber Eats (or similar) and no food delivery. Restaurants observe small town hours. This is a coastal water-front home. Local and non-local heavy rains impact the water levels of Caney Creek. Severe weather (ex: tropical storms, hurricanes, severe freezes) may impact the amenities, availability of the creek, and in severe situations make this home unavailable. Safety: It is up to guests to ensure that they will keep children and non-swimmers in their site at all times. This property is on a natural water source and there are no safety mechanisms in place to prevent swimming, or swimming related accidents, such as fencing or gates. If you are traveling with a non-swimmer child, infant, or individual with special needs, please be aware of this. Further, this section of the creek has sharp oyster shells at the bottom. It is not recommended to swim in this area nor to enter the water from the land, pier or similar, at this property. This house has elevated living quarters. There is no screening, nor gates, at the stairwells or railings. Guests are responsible for keeping children in sight to avoid any falls through the porch railings or stairwells.
